    Prius Option- Need Advice

    Hi!
    I am buying 2008 touring #6. I need explanation what is the meaning of

    [FONT=&quot] Factory Installed Accessories: FE NR TV
    Port Installed Accessories ..: CF EF
    [/FONT]I am buying it for $27461 + Tax. Is this a good price?

    I know that back east they are selling Prius at MSRP, mih be the same in Kansas, as they probably don't have many Prius for sale. In California there is a stiff competition by dealers as there are tons of Prius being sold here, and tons of dealers competing for your dollar, so it's cheaper to buy here. I just paid $25,118 (plus tax, reg, etc) for my Prius Touring with package 6 today, will pick her up Thursday or Friday. I was thinking of buying it in Nashville, TN before, but they are not going below MSRP in TN, so I bought it here in CA. MSRP for the same car according to he Toyota website would have been $28,440.

    CF = Carpted Floor Mats
    FE = 50 State Emissions certified
    NR = Package 6
    TV = Touring Edition
